Manufacturing WIP, coupled with real-time accounting and inventory management, involves tracking products in the production process in real-time. This comprehensive approach ensures immediate financial recording and precise cost monitoring, encompassing labor, materials, and overheads. Simultaneously, it allows for seamless inventory tracking, optimizing stock levels and production scheduling.
Manufacturing WIP variance denotes the deviations between projected and actual costs in the production process. It highlights discrepancies, enabling analysis of factors affecting cost fluctuations, such as material prices, labor efficiency, or production volume changes, aiding informed decision-making and process optimization.
Cost adjustment involves revising financial figures to reflect accurate expenses. In manufacturing Work in Progress (WIP), cost adjustments ensure precise accounting for ongoing production stages, optimizing resource allocation and budget accuracy.
